Understanding LED Technology
LED lighting has revolutionized the way we illuminate our spaces, both indoors and outdoors. LEDs, or Light Emitting Diodes, are semiconductor devices that emit light when an electric current passes through them. Compared to traditional incandescent and fluorescent lighting, LEDs provide greater efficiency, longevity, and versatility.
The invention of LEDs dates back several decades, but it is their recent development that has led to their widespread use. Unlike traditional bulbs that rely on heating a filament, LEDs create light through electroluminescence, making them much more energy-efficient. This core technological difference is what allows LEDs to use significantly less energy and produce less heat while delivering high-quality illumination.
The Basics of LED
At its core, an LED consists of a chip coated in a phosphor material. When electricity flows through the chip, electrons combine with hole carriers, resulting in the release of energy in the form of photons. This process results in light generation. The color of the light emitted depends on the materials used in the semiconductor chip, which can be modified to create various colors.
Additionally, LEDs can be incorporated into various fixtures and designs, allowing for a wide range of aesthetic applications. Their compact size affords greater flexibility in design, enabling innovative lighting solutions for gardens, pathways, and architectural components. For instance, LED strip lights can be used to create stunning visual effects in both residential and commercial spaces, enhancing the ambiance and functionality of the environment.
How LED Lights Work
LED lights operate using a relatively simple principle but offer a multitude of advantages. When an LED is connected to a power source, it allows electrons to flow across a semiconductor junction, leading to the emission of light through the release of energy in the form of photons.
One of the key aspects of LED technology is that it allows for dimming capabilities without affecting the color quality. Moreover, the ability to precisely control light emission enables LED fixtures to be designed for specific tasks, like directed lighting for security, or softer ambient lighting within a landscape design. This adaptability makes LEDs ideal for both functional and decorative purposes, as they can be tailored to meet the specific needs of any space.
Benefits of Using LED Lights
Choosing LED lights for exterior applications comes with numerous benefits. Firstly, they are exceptionally energy-efficient, using up to 80% less electricity than traditional lighting options. This translates to significant cost savings on energy bills.
Secondly, LED lights boast a remarkably long lifespan, often lasting up to 25,000 hours or more. This durability not only reduces the frequency of replacements but also minimizes waste, making them an environmentally friendly choice. The longevity of LEDs also means less disruption for maintenance, which is particularly beneficial in commercial settings where uptime is crucial.
Furthermore, LEDs have a lower environmental impact due to their lack of toxic materials like mercury, commonly found in other types of light bulbs. Their instant-on technology means there is no warm-up time, which enhances usability in areas where immediate lighting is crucial. Additionally, the robust nature of LEDs makes them resistant to shock and vibration, making them suitable for a variety of applications, from residential lighting to industrial environments. Their ability to perform well in extreme temperatures further adds to their versatility, making them a reliable choice for outdoor installations in diverse climates.
Types of LED Exterior Lighting
When it comes to illuminating outdoor spaces, a variety of LED lighting types are available to suit specific needs and environments. From security to aesthetic enhancement, the following types are some of the most popular options.
Wall Lights
LED wall lights serve both functional and decorative purposes. They can be mounted on exterior walls, providing necessary illumination for walkways or entrances while also enhancing architectural features. The design flexibility allows for various styles, from sleek modern fixtures to more traditional lantern types.
Additionally, wall lights can often be adjusted to direct light where it is needed most, enhancing safety and security in poorly lit areas. Many modern LED wall lights come with smart technology, allowing homeowners to control them via smartphone apps or voice-activated devices. This feature not only adds convenience but also enables users to create custom lighting schedules or adjust brightness levels based on the time of day or specific events.
Landscape Lights
Landscape lighting transforms outdoor spaces into beautiful, illuminated areas during the nighttime. LED landscape lights come in various forms, such as spotlights, path lights, and inground fixtures. Spotlights can accentuate certain features of a garden, while path lights guide the way along walkways.
Moreover, the adjustable brightness levels of LED landscape lights provide homeowners the option to create different atmospheres, perfect for both intimate gatherings and festive occasions. These fixtures are often designed to blend seamlessly into the environment, further enhancing the natural beauty of outdoor spaces. Additionally, many landscape lights are equipped with color-changing capabilities, allowing homeowners to switch between different hues to match seasonal themes or special occasions, adding a dynamic element to their outdoor decor.
Security Lights
Security is paramount in exterior lighting, and LED security lights offer bright, focused illumination ideal for deterring intruders. They are frequently equipped with motion sensors, ensuring that lights turn on only when movement is detected.
These lights are durable and designed to withstand harsh weather conditions, making them suitable for all outdoor environments. Their bright output not only provides safety but also enhances visibility, allowing homeowners to feel secure at night. Some models even include features such as integrated cameras or alarms, providing an added layer of security that can be monitored remotely, giving homeowners peace of mind while they are away from their property.
Deck and Step Lights
For residential properties with outdoor decks or stairs, LED deck and step lights provide both safety and ambiance. They light up pathways and stairs, reducing the risk of tripping in low-light conditions. Available as embedded options or surface-mounted designs, these lights can be integrated into the architecture for a seamless look.
In addition to safety, deck lights can create a warm and inviting atmosphere for evening gatherings or relaxation, allowing homeowners to enjoy their outdoor spaces late into the night. Many deck lights are designed with energy efficiency in mind, utilizing solar power or low-voltage systems, which not only reduces electricity costs but also minimizes environmental impact. With various color temperatures available, homeowners can choose lights that emit a soft, warm glow or a brighter, cooler light, depending on the mood they wish to create for their outdoor living areas.
Factors to Consider When Choosing LED Exterior Lighting
Selecting the right LED exterior lighting involves considering various factors to ensure functionality and aesthetic appeal. Important aspects to keep in mind include brightness, energy efficiency, and durability.
Brightness and Color Temperature
Brightness is measured in lumens, and understanding how much light is required for specific spaces is crucial. For instance, walkway lighting typically requires lower lumens compared to security or task lighting. Selecting the appropriate level enhances safety while also fulfilling the intended purpose without being overly harsh.
Color temperature, measured in Kelvins, plays a significant role in ambiance. Lower temperatures (warm white) create a cozy atmosphere, while higher temperatures (cool white) provide a more vibrant, daylight-like quality. Carefully considering these aspects will help achieve the desired mood.
Energy Efficiency
Since energy efficiency is one of the greatest advantages of LED technology, it’s important to choose fixtures that maximize this benefit. Look for products with Energy Star ratings, which signifies that they meet strict efficiency guidelines.
In addition, consider the operation of the lights. Features like dimming options and timers can further enhance energy savings and reduce electricity costs over time.
Durability and Lifespan
Given that LED lighting is used outdoors, exposure to various environmental elements necessitates durable fixtures. Look for lights constructed with weather-resistant materials that can withstand rain, snow, and humidity.
The lifespan of the fixtures should also be taken into account; high-quality LEDs can last for tens of thousands of hours. Ensuring that chosen lighting options are well-rated for durability can save costs on replacements and maintenance in the long run.
Installation of LED Exterior Lighting
Once the right exterior LED lights have been selected, the next step is installation. Depending on the complexity of the setup, this can often be done by the homeowner or may require professional assistance.
DIY Installation Tips
For those who prefer taking a hands-on approach, LED exterior lighting installation can be a rewarding DIY project. Begin by carefully planning the layout of the lights to achieve optimal illumination and aesthetic balance.
Ensure all electrical components are safe and up to code. Use tools appropriate for the installation type, such as wiring tools and anchors. It is important to follow manufacturers’ instructions for connections and fixings, ensuring all fixtures are secured properly.
Professional Installation: What to Expect
If opting for professional installation, it is essential to communicate clearly about your vision and requirements. An experienced electrician will assess the space, make recommendations, and ensure that all electrical work complies with local codes.
Professionals will handle wiring and mounting efficiently, providing peace of mind that the installation has been completed safely. Their expertise often results in optimal placement of lights for both aesthetic appeal and functional use, ensuring your outdoor spaces are beautifully lit.
